The Importance Of Optimisation Of Heating & Cooling For A Comfortable Home

When it comes to creating a comfortable living space, one of the key factors to consider is the optimisation of heating and cooling systems Properly regulating the temperature in your home not only ensures that you are comfortable year-round but also plays a significant role in reducing energy consumption and costs In this article, we will discuss the importance of optimising heating and cooling systems in your home.

Efficiently managing the temperature in your home is crucial for several reasons Firstly, maintaining a comfortable indoor temperature improves overall well-being and productivity Extreme temperatures can have a negative impact on your health and mood, leading to discomfort and decreased productivity By optimising your heating and cooling systems, you can create a pleasant living environment that promotes well-being and enhances quality of life.

Secondly, optimising heating and cooling systems can help reduce energy consumption and lower utility bills Heating and cooling account for a significant portion of household energy usage, so making sure that these systems are operating efficiently can result in substantial savings By using energy-efficient appliances, properly insulating your home, and implementing smart temperature control strategies, you can reduce energy waste and cut down on your monthly expenses.

Additionally, optimising heating and cooling systems is essential for environmental sustainability The excessive use of energy to heat and cool buildings contributes to greenhouse gas emissions and exacerbates climate change By improving the efficiency of your heating and cooling systems, you can reduce your carbon footprint and help protect the environment for future generations.

There are several ways to optimise heating and cooling systems in your home One of the simplest yet most effective strategies is to invest in energy-efficient appliances Energy-efficient heating and cooling units are designed to use less energy while still providing reliable performance optimisation of heating & cooling. Look for appliances with high ENERGY STAR ratings, as these products meet strict energy efficiency guidelines set by the Environmental Protection Agency.

Proper insulation is another crucial aspect of optimising heating and cooling systems Insulation helps to retain heat in the winter and keep it out in the summer, reducing the workload on your heating and cooling units Make sure that your home is well-insulated in key areas such as walls, windows, doors, and the attic to prevent energy loss and maintain a consistent indoor temperature.

Implementing smart temperature control strategies can also help optimise heating and cooling systems Programmable thermostats allow you to set specific temperature settings for different times of the day, ensuring that your heating and cooling systems are only operating when needed Smart thermostats take this a step further by learning your preferences and adjusting temperature settings automatically to maximise energy efficiency.

Regular maintenance is essential for optimising heating and cooling systems Dirty filters, clogged ducts, and other issues can reduce the efficiency of your heating and cooling units, leading to higher energy consumption and decreased performance By scheduling routine maintenance checks and cleaning or replacing filters as needed, you can ensure that your systems are operating at peak efficiency.
